The Terro Victor M380 Fly Magnet is a reusable, plastic fly trap featuring a non-toxic bait that safely attracts and traps multiple fly species. Compact and lightweight, it’s designed for outdoor use around children and pets, boasting a strong 4.2-star rating from over 13,700 customers since 2012.

We ordered this fly trap because we kept having flies bite us as we sat at our patio drying off after getting out of pool. First day I got it, in the morning I hung it under the eaves of our tractor shed. That afternoon we all hopped in the pool which is near the patio and both are maybe 400 ft. from the shed. My wife suddenly turned around and asked me "What IS THAT?" I pointed to the corner of the shed. I guess the wind had changed direction or something because suddenly she was gagging. I told her where I had hung it and she insisted I get out of the pool then and there and take it "far, far away". When I went to move it, it was already almost 1/3 full of flies, and I'm not sure if it was because of our Mississippi heat for 4 or 5 hours or the dead flies in there or what, but somehow it smelled even worse than when I had first put it out. My wife and daughter watched as I moved it another five or six hundred feet down the hill and hung it in a tree at the edge of our woods. It sloshed around a little bit and I couldn't help it...I started gagging real bad. My wife was laughing from the pool as I dry heaved. The closest thing I can compare the smell to would-be the latrines out in the heat when I was deployed in Kuwait. Maybe toss in some rotten meat smell too. I can see why the flies were highly attracted to it. I cautiously checked it three days later and it was completely full of flies. If you can find a good place to put this near your home or barn where you won't be around it, it is fantastic. I think it would be awesome around a barn because I did see a lot of horse flies in the trap. Just beware if you have a weak stomach. Do NOT open it inside your house or anywhere where you don't want a stench if you were to spill it. I showed it to my father-in-law who thinks it would be the ultimate tool for a prank. All in all I highly recommend it for getting rid of flies.

I purchased this for in door use, as i had fly issue in the back of the house After a few days the smell was disgusting and it wasn't being that effective so I moved it outside, just out of the way. Within a couple of days the trap was fully active, capturing flies at an amazing rate. the house remained clear of most flies (just not the really really small ones). This is highly recommended - if you want it for a BBQ or specific date, its worth setting up a few days in advance as it takes some time for it to get going.
